Proposed
1. Victoria Sur Le Parc (80%+ units sold, will start within the next few months) 200 metres/656 feet
2. National Bank/Banque National new HQ (1.1 million square feet) 200 metres/656 ft
3. Maestria (still waiting for approval and consultations, doesn't need a waiver for increased height either) 168 metres/ 551 feet x2
4. Solstice- 147.5 metres/ 484 feet
5. 1000 De La Montagne- 144 metres/472.5 feet
6. Quinzicent- 120 metres

Under Construction
1. Tour des Canadiens phase two and three (both 168 metres/551 feet)
2. Humaniti (120 metres/394 feet) will have commercial, office space, a hotel (Marriot of course), rental and condo
3. 628 St. Jacques street (120m/394 ft). Taking a while but work is ongoing
4. Phase two of YUL (120 metres)
5. Est/West (2x 95 metres/312 ft)
6. Union Sur Le Parc (2x 80 metres)- Phase one
7. Centra Condos Phase two
8. Laurent and Clark phase one
